Transaction 9652d50dee482fbeeb012b878b76a8e9529d69545c985dab678722cc5514ee42

4 Input
2 Outputs
  • 9652d50dee482fbeeb012b878b76a8e9529d69545c985dab678722cc5514ee42:0
  • value  226718363
    address  31o2vXASQLSougKfVrR7oPL2unk9cxtpg5
  • 9652d50dee482fbeeb012b878b76a8e9529d69545c985dab678722cc5514ee42:1
  • value  8170989125
    address  3MqUP6G1daVS5YTD8fz3QgwjZortWwxXFd